Not only the location right on the waterfront is excellent, local life is happening right around you. People gather at different times of the day to catch fish, clean it, prepare tools, meet to chat or simply sit quietly (without smart-phones, nice). The peace all around is a blessing. There's an improvised miniature chicken farm right around the corner (five roosters make themselves heard :)
Two little shops 5 minutes away provide the basics and sometimes even fresh veggies. For 'night-life' there is a funky bar nearby with music, where you can sit outside and sample various home made drinks and temperaments.
The kitchen is well equipped and I found rice, sugar etc. at my disposal. On festive days, Regina opens her little food stall in front of the house and neighbors come together. Regina is an energetic, cool and thoroughly helpful landlady.
